Producer's Choice, Grassland Central and Target Seeds are merging to operate as Producer's Choice

.

Woodland, California
June 23, 2008

Effective June 16, 2008, Grassland Central’s offices located in Jordan, Minnesota will become the Midwest base of operations for Producer’s Choice. Dallas Grekoff and the entire staff of Grassland Central will continue to provide their customers with products and services. "We are excited about our merger and are looking forward to our being the central location for Producer's Choice. This merger will ensure that our customers will have access to the additional varieties and species that will benefit their changing needs,” states Dallas Grekoff.

Jon Watson and Tom Baxter, the founders of Target Seeds, will continue to produce alfalfa and Teff Seed for the company in their Idaho farming operations. “This merger makes it possible for the company we started to go to the next level and will allow us to focus on our core competency of agricultural production. Producer’s Choice will have access to leading edge technologies being developed by the parent company Cal/West Seeds”, adds Jon Watson. Key employees of Target Seed will continue in new roles with Producers’ Choice. Tom Miles becomes the Regional Manager for Producer’s Choice in the Pacific Northwest. Dr. Don Miller becomes the Director of Product Development for Producers Choice Seed. Gene Lind will continue to work with key customers in a sales role.

Producer’s Choice, was launched in 2001 as a wholly owned subsidiary of Cal/West Seeds, recognized globally as a leader in forage seeds for over 70 years. Prior to the initiation of Producer’s Choice, Cal/West Seeds did business primarily via exclusive licensing arrangements with seed companies. The accelerated consolidation of the seed industry was a catalyst for the initiative, providing a stable channel for the company’s products to be distributed to growers. Producer’s Choice acquired the assets of PGI Alfalfa in 2005.

The merger with Grassland Central and Target Seeds is a significant step as Producer’s Choice expands towards becoming a national brand specializing in grass and legume seeds, offering dealers and producers leading edge genetics and new technologies. Producer’s Choice dealers will now have a much broader portfolio of products to offer including forage and turf grasses as well as numerous forage mixes.

Terms of the transaction were not announced.
